Baba Ramdev promoted Patanjali Ayurved on Monday announced the launch of instant atta noodles, a week after foods giant Nestle announced the relaunch of its Rs 2,000-crore Maggi noodles. The noodles will be sold through 5,000-plus chikitsalayas and arogya kendras besides Big Bazaar and Reliance Fresh, company officials said.
Patanjali already sells products like creams and shampoo under its label.
